Abstract

This research aimed to identify the differences in pragmatic language disorder among autistic children in light of age, gender (male- female), mother’s educational level and autism spectrum disorder level, participants of the study were (55) autistic children, (30) males, (25) females. The study used pragmatic language disorder scale (prepared by Abdulaziz Alshakhs), and (Gilliam Autism Rating Scale translated and codified by Adel Abdalla,). The results of the study indicated that there were statistically significant differences in pragmatic language disorder according to age (6,7-8,9) years in favor of the young aged children (8,9 years). There were also statistically significant differences in pragmatic language disorder according to  mother’s educational level in favor  of illiterate mothers. The study indicated that there was no difference of statistical significant in pragmatic language disorder between males and females. Finally, there were also statistically significant difference in pragmatic language disorder according to autistic children level in favor of severe autism.
